The LTC6811G-1#TRPBF is a highly sophisticated battery stack monitor developed by Linear Technology, designed to ensure the reliable and accurate monitoring of multicell battery stacks. This high-performance device is particularly suitable for electric vehicles, energy storage systems, and other applications that require precise battery monitoring to maintain safety and efficiency.
Key Features
- Multicell Measurement: Capable of measuring up to 12 series-connected battery cells with a total measurement error of less than 1.2mV.
- High Voltage Capability: The device can handle voltages up to 1000V, making it suitable for high voltage battery management systems.
- Multiple Communication Options: It includes an isoSPI interface for high-speed, RF-immune, long-distance communications, ensuring robust data transmission even in harsh environments.
- Integrated Temperature Sensing: Offers onboard temperature sensing to monitor the condition of the battery cells, which is crucial for safety and longevity.
- Configurable: Users can configure the LTC6811G-1#TRPBF for various measurement and monitoring scenarios, providing flexibility for different system designs.
- Robust Design: The device features a rugged design that can withstand the automotive environment, including under-the-hood temperatures.

Technical Specifications
| Parameter |
Value |
| Cell Voltage Measurement |
0.3V to 5V |
| Total Measurement Error |
< 1.2mV |
| Operating Temperature Range |
-40°C to +125°C |
| Communication Interface |
isoSPI |
| Package |
48-lead SSOP |
